Buying Guide for the Best most powerful electric leaf blower

Choosing the right electric leaf blower can make yard work much easier and more efficient. When selecting a leaf blower,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get a model that fits your needs. Understanding these specs will help you make an informed decision and find the best fit for your specific requirements.
Power (Amps/Volts)The power of an electric leaf blower is typically measured in amps (for corded models) or volts (for cordless models). This spec indicates the strength of the motor and its ability to move leaves and debris. Higher amps or volts mean more power. For light yard work, a blower with lower power (around 7-12 amps or 20-40 volts) may suffice. For larger areas or tougher jobs, look for higher power (12-15 amps or 40-60 volts). Choose based on the size of your yard and the type of debris you need to clear.
Airflow (CFM)CFM stands for cubic feet per minute and measures the volume of air the blower can move. This spec is crucial because it determines how much debris the blower can move at once. For small yards or light tasks, a CFM of 200-400 is usually adequate. For larger yards or heavy-duty tasks, look for a CFM of 400-600 or more. Consider the type of debris and the size of the area you need to clear when choosing the right CFM.
Air Speed (MPH)Air speed, measured in miles per hour (MPH), indicates how fast the air is moving out of the blower. Higher air speed can help move heavier debris and wet leaves. For light tasks, an air speed of 100-150 MPH may be sufficient. For more demanding tasks, look for air speeds of 150-250 MPH or higher. Match the air speed to the type of debris and the conditions in your yard.
WeightThe weight of the leaf blower is important for ease of use and comfort, especially if you have a large area to cover. Lighter models (under 8 pounds) are easier to handle and maneuver, making them suitable for smaller yards or shorter tasks. Heavier models (8-12 pounds or more) may offer more power but can be tiring to use for extended periods. Consider your physical strength and the duration of use when choosing the right weight.
Noise LevelNoise level, measured in decibels (dB), is an important consideration, especially if you live in a neighborhood with noise restrictions or if you prefer a quieter operation. Lower noise levels (under 70 dB) are more neighbor-friendly and less likely to cause hearing damage. Higher noise levels (70-90 dB) may be more powerful but can be disruptive. Choose a noise level that balances power and comfort for your specific situation.
Battery Life (for cordless models)For cordless electric leaf blowers, battery life is a key spec to consider. It determines how long you can use the blower on a single charge. Shorter battery life (15-30 minutes) may be sufficient for small yards or quick tasks. Longer battery life (30-60 minutes or more) is better for larger areas or extended use. Consider the size of your yard and the typical duration of your tasks when choosing the right battery life.
Ergonomics and FeaturesErgonomics and additional features can greatly enhance the usability and comfort of a leaf blower. Look for features like adjustable handles, variable speed settings, and easy-to-use controls. Ergonomic designs reduce strain and fatigue, making the blower more comfortable to use for extended periods. Consider your personal comfort and any specific features that would make the blower easier and more enjoyable to use.
